I'm not going to offer an opinion on the subject matter, but I will say I'm a sucker for cards that offer a 0% into 12-18 months and cash for spend bonuses. I usually have at least one or two 0% promotions going and on average I made $400 to $1000 a year in spend-bonuses. I don't usually close the account right after the offers expire, but I value the card for what it is as far as spending after the promotions expire. I also make sure I don't carry a balance after the intro period and make sure I meet the spend requirement for the cash back.
If a card is going to pay me to use their card interest-free, who am I to say no thanks I don't like free money?
